description |
Megan Webb interviews Neil Shea about his familial relation to a past owner of the Fowler House in Brigus, his time spent there in the summers, and the layout of the house prior to rennovations. 0:00 Start of recording; 0:27 Hello; 1:20 Introductions; 1:42 Connection to Fowler House; 3:45 Sadie (nee Shea) Fowler; 5:35 Thinking Richard’s parents owned the house before Rich & Sadie took over, his mother lived with them for a period of time; 6:15 Rich had a sister maybe named Madeline; 6:55 Layout of house in 1950s and 60s; 8:01 No indoor plumbing, just an outhouse up the hill and a washbasin; 8:30 Spare room in back on 2nd floor entrance to twine loft or up ladder from store; 9:09 A lot of acreage - grew potatoes, turnips, cabbages; 9:28 Next to kitchen had a coal shed, just down from that was a chicken coop; 9:45 Rich owned a small wharf, large fishing shed, and boat in key down from bridge; 10:55 Two stoves on 1st floor; 11:30 Explanation of layout of 1st floor; 12:40 Second floor layout; 14:56 Sadie approached from Brigus Historical Society about preserving house when Rich went into a home; 21:12 Remembering the pantry, kitchen, and the stairs from 1st to 2nd floor; 21:50 Location of the pantry; 22:00 Kept “perishables” on rock wall in the pantry as it was colder; 22:26 Hand pump in basin in kitchen feeding off natural well; 22:38 Trout in the well; 23:22 Chicken coop for fresh eggs; 23:50 Kitchen had a wood stove, in the 80s got an oil stove; 24:17 Coal shed to feed the stoves; 25:32 Location of wood stoves; 36:23 Memory of his sister’s casket & wake held at Fowler house 1965; 51:20 Thanks; 51:49 End of recording. |
